Open-label Study of the Long-Term Efficacy of Intranasal Oxytocin in Patients With Schizophrenia
The Objective of this study is to investigate the long-term efficacy of intranasal oxytocin in improvement of symptoms in patients with schizophrenia who have residual symptoms dispute being on adequate treatment with antipsychotic medication.
Approximately 20 patients will be enrolled to participate in a 6 month flexible dose of oxytocin.
